| February 27, 2006 | 8 | ORDER granting 7: Motion to Remand. For the reasons stated in the order herein, the Commissioner's request to remand is GRANTED. Accordingly, this case is REMANDED to the Social Security Commission. Should the record not be located, a hearing de novo must take place. The appropriate remedy is to be provided by the Commissioner and such remedy may, then, be subject of a new appeal. Judgment will be issued accordingly. Signed by Judge Daniel R Dominguez on 2/27/06.
